Abstract

The invention relates to a self-powered device for a door. The device comprises a crank handle (1), a gear device (2), a generator and an electric power storage circuit, wherein the tail end of the crank handle (1) is connected with the gear device (2); the gear device (2) is fixed on the generator; the crank handle (1) is shaken, and the generator is driven to rotate together through the transmission of the gear device (2); and the generator rotates for generation and transmits electric power into the electric power storage circuit so as to supply power to an electronic device. Through the invention, the electronic device on the door is effectively prevented from being influenced by electric power. The device has the advantages of simple structure and low cost, and is environment-friendly.
